西安微信小程序费用预算详细分析
在数字化转型浪潮下,微信小程序已成为西安乃至全国企业拓展线上业务、连接用户的重要工具。无论是餐饮零售、旅游服务,还是教育培训、政务民生,小程序都展现出巨大的潜力。然而,当企业决定投身小程序开发时,最关心的问题之一便是:“做一个微信小程序到底需要多少钱?” 这个问题的答案并非一个简单的数字,它受到功能复杂度、开发模式、后期维护等多重因素影响。本文将为您详细拆解西安地区微信小程序的费用构成,并提供一份清晰的预算分析框架,帮助您做出明智的决策。同时,文中也会提及郑州、洛阳、焦作等地的开发市场情况,以供对比参考。
一、 影响小程序开发成本的核心因素
在讨论具体费用前,必须明确影响成本的核心变量。理解这些因素,是进行精准预算的第一步。
1. 功能需求与复杂度
这是决定成本的最主要因素。功能越复杂,开发周期越长,人力成本越高。
- 展示型小程序: 主要用于展示企业信息、产品介绍、联系方式等。功能简单,通常包含首页、关于我们、产品/服务列表、联系我们等页面。开发成本最低。
- 商城型小程序: 具备完整的电商功能,如商品分类、购物车、在线支付(微信支付)、订单管理、物流跟踪、会员系统、优惠券、拼团/秒杀等。复杂度中等偏高,是市场主流需求。
- 服务预订/预约型小程序: 适用于餐饮、美容、家政、教育等行业。核心功能包括服务项目展示、在线预约、时间选择、支付定金、技师/教室选择等。
- 社交/社区型小程序: 包含用户发布内容、点赞评论、私信聊天、动态分享等功能。对实时性、数据交互和后台管理要求高,开发成本高。
- 工具型小程序: 如计算器、打卡、表单收集、文件处理等。功能深度决定成本,若涉及复杂算法或与硬件交互,成本会显著增加。
2. 开发模式的选择
不同的开发模式,对应着截然不同的成本结构和最终产品。
- 模板SaaS化开发: 使用第三方平台(如有赞、微盟)提供的行业模板,快速搭建。优点是成本极低(通常每年几千元服务费),上线快。缺点是功能固化,无法深度定制,设计同质化严重,数据可能受限于平台。
- 定制化开发: 由专业开发团队(如西安的软件公司或开发工作室)根据您的需求,从零开始设计、编码。优点是功能完全匹配需求,用户体验好,代码自主可控,易于后期扩展。缺点是周期长,成本高。
- 混合开发(半定制): 在成熟框架或基础模板上进行二次开发。能在控制成本的同时,实现一定程度的个性化。这是许多中小企业的折中选择。
3. 设计水平与交互体验
UI/UX设计是用户对产品的第一印象。一套优秀的定制化UI设计,需要专业设计师投入时间进行用户研究、原型设计、视觉定稿,这部分成本不容忽视。简单的套用模板设计成本低,但难以形成品牌辨识度。
4. 后期维护与服务器成本
小程序上线并非终点。持续的维护(Bug修复、兼容性调整)、功能迭代、服务器租赁(云服务如阿里云、腾讯云)、域名、SSL证书等,都是持续的支出项。这部分预算必须在项目初期就考虑在内。
二、 西安小程序开发费用明细拆解
基于以上因素,我们可以对西安市场的开发费用进行一个大致估算。以下价格基于定制化开发模式。
1. 展示型小程序
- 功能范围: 5-8个页面,图文展示,地图定位,在线客服。
- 开发周期: 2-4周。
- 费用估算: 5,000 - 15,000 元人民币。
- 技术说明: 主要使用微信小程序原生框架(WXML、WXSS、JS),后端可能使用云开发或简单的云函数,减少服务器成本。
2. 标准商城型小程序
- 功能范围: 完整的商品管理、购物流程、用户中心、基础营销工具(优惠券)、微信支付集成。
- 开发周期: 4-8周。
- 费用估算: 20,000 - 60,000 元人民币。若包含分销、直播、复杂的会员体系,费用会更高。
- 技术说明: 前端为小程序,后端通常需要独立的服务器和数据库(如 MySQL)。支付接口调用是关键环节,需严格遵循微信支付安全规范。
// 示例:一个简化的微信支付统一下单参数组装(Node.js后端)
const unifiedOrderParams = {
appid: ‘你的小程序AppID’,
mch_id: ‘你的商户号’,
nonce_str: generateNonceStr(), // 生成随机字符串
body: ‘商品描述’,
out_trade_no: ‘商户订单号’,
total_fee: 100, // 单位:分
spbill_create_ip: ‘用户IP’,
notify_url: ‘支付结果回调地址’,
trade_type: ‘JSAPI’,
openid: ‘用户的openid’
};
// 需要按照微信规则签名,并发送XML格式请求到微信支付API
3. 中大型定制化项目
- 功能范围: 多角色后台管理(如平台方、商户、用户)、实时通讯、复杂数据可视化、与第三方系统(ERP、CRM)对接、定制算法等。
- 开发周期: 3个月以上。
- 费用估算: 80,000 元人民币起,上不封顶,具体根据需求评估。
- 技术栈可能涉及: 小程序原生 + 第三方框架(如 Taro、uni-app 以实现多端),后端采用 Java/Go/Python/Node.js,数据库根据场景选用关系型或非关系型,服务器采用分布式架构以应对高并发。
4. 持续成本(年费)
- 服务器与域名: 根据配置和流量,约 1,000 - 10,000 元/年。
- 微信认证费: 300 元/年(如果使用已认证公众号复用资质,则无需额外付费)。
- 技术维护费: 通常为项目初开发费用的 15%-20%/年,用于系统维护、安全更新和应急处理。
三、 如何选择靠谱的开发服务商?
在西安、郑州、洛阳、焦作等地,都有大量的软件开发公司和个人开发者。如何甄别?
1. 评估团队专业性
- 案例考察: 要求查看他们过往的真实案例,最好能亲自体验其开发的小程序,关注流畅度、UI设计和功能完整性。
- 技术沟通: 与对方的技术负责人沟通,看其是否能清晰理解你的业务,并提出专业的技术实现方案和潜在风险点。
- 流程规范: 正规公司会有明确的需求调研、原型设计、UI评审、开发测试、上线部署的流程,并提供项目管理和沟通工具(如TAPD、Teambition)。
2. 明确合同与交付物
合同是保障双方权益的关键。合同中必须明确:
- 详细的功能需求清单(可作为附件)。
- 项目里程碑、付款节点(通常按3:3:3:1或类似比例分期)。
- 交付物清单(源代码、设计源文件、数据库设计文档、操作手册等)。
- 知识产权归属(务必约定源码所有权归委托方)。
- 售后服务期限和范围(如免费维护期多长,响应时间等)。
3. 警惕低价陷阱
远低于市场价的报价往往意味着:使用盗版模板、代码质量低下、后期加价、甚至中途跑路。开发是一个智力密集型工作,合理的价格是对专业和质量的保障。郑州、洛阳、焦作等地的开发成本与西安相比,人力成本可能略低,但核心定价逻辑是一致的。
四、 技术选型与成本优化建议
1. 善用微信云开发
对于中小型项目,微信官方推出的云开发是一个极佳的降本增效方案。它集成了云函数、数据库、存储和静态托管,开发者无需自行搭建和维护后端服务器,可以专注于业务逻辑。
// 云开发示例:在小程序端直接操作数据库
const db = wx.cloud.database();
db.collection(‘goods’).where({
category: ‘electronics’
}).get().then(res => {
console.log(res.data); // 获取商品数据
}).catch(err => {
console.error(err);
});
这大大降低了后端开发的难度和服务器运维成本,特别适合初创项目或功能简单的MVP(最小可行产品)。
2. 采用跨端框架
如果你的业务未来需要扩展到H5网站或App,可以考虑使用Taro、uni-app等跨端框架。它们支持用一套代码编译到微信小程序、支付宝小程序、H5乃至iOS/Android App。虽然初期学习或开发成本可能略高,但从长远看,节省了多端重复开发的巨大成本。
3. 分阶段开发
不要试图在第一版就实现所有梦想功能。采用敏捷开发模式,先开发核心功能(MVP)上线验证市场,然后根据用户反馈和数据,规划后续迭代版本。这样既能控制初期投入,又能让产品方向更贴合市场需求。
总结
西安微信小程序的开发费用是一个动态范围,从几千元的模板到数十万元的深度定制项目不等。关键在于明确自身的业务需求、目标用户和预算范围。对于大多数西安的中小企业而言,一个功能完善的商城或服务预约类小程序的定制开发,预算在3万到8万元之间是一个比较合理的区间。
在寻找合作伙伴时,无论是西安本地,还是郑州、洛阳、焦作的团队,都应把专业能力、沟通效率和项目保障放在比价格更优先的位置。建议前期投入足够时间进行需求梳理和市场调研,与多家服务商深入沟通,获取详细的报价方案和开发计划,最终选择最匹配、最可信赖的团队合作。
记住,小程序不仅是一个技术产品,更是您商业战略的数字化延伸。合理的预算规划和专业的开发执行,将为您在激烈的市场竞争中赢得宝贵的先机。




